>>>>> "David" == David Morris <Morris> writes:
David> Day one of attempted Exchange migration :-( Does anyone
David> know what SMTP error code 442 is?
See the following RFCs:
http://rfc.sunsite.dk/rfc/rfc2034.html
http://rfc.sunsite.dk/rfc/rfc1893.html
1893 says:
4.X.X Persistent Transient Failure
A persistent transient failure is one in which the message as
sent is valid, but some temporary event prevents the successful
sending of the message. Sending in the future may be
successful.
X.4.X Network and Routing Status
The networking or routing codes report status about the
delivery system itself. These system components include any
necessary infrastructure such as directory and routing
services. Network issues are assumed to be under the
control of the destination or intermediate system
administrator.
X.4.2 Bad connection
The outbound connection was established, but was otherwise
unable to complete the message transaction, either because
of time-out, or inadequate connection quality. This is
useful only as a persistent transient error.
So, I guess the answer is persistent dodgy connection :-)
